Low-pressure vessel manufacturing refers to the production process of pressure vessels with a design pressure ranging from 0.1 MPa to 1.6 MPa. It is based on strict compliance with national and industry standards (such as GB 150 and ASME Ⅷ), and ensures quality throughout the entire process, including raw material inspection, cutting and forming, welding…

I. Standards and Specifications (Basic Bases)
Domestic Standards
- GB 150《Pressure Vessels》: General requirements covering the entire process, including design, manufacturing, and inspection.
- GB 151《Heat Exchangers》: Specific requirements for heat exchanger-type pressure vessels.
- TSG 21《Safety Technical Code for Fixed Pressure Vessels》: Statutory regulatory requirements that must be strictly adhered to.
- GB/T 15704《Steel Forgings for Pressure Vessels》: Requirements for material quality.
International Standards
- ASME Ⅷ《Pressure Vessels》: Widely recognized globally, applicable to exported products.
- EN 13445《Pressure Equipment Directive》: Standard of the European Union.
II. Material Requirements (Core Foundation)
Material Selection
- Common Materials: Q345R (Low-alloy High-strength Steel for Vessels), 16MnR, Stainless Steel (304/316L), Carbon Steel, etc.
- Material Requirements: Must possess good strength, toughness, and weldability, and be accompanied by valid material certificates (quality assurance documents).
Material Inspection
- Incoming Inspection: Verify material certificates, perform spectral analysis, and conduct mechanical property tests.
- Unauthorized Use of Unqualified or Counterfeit Materials is Strictly Prohibited.
III. Manufacturing Equipment and Processes
Main Equipment
- Cutting Equipment: CNC Plasma Cutters, Laser Cutters (to ensure precision of material cutting).
- Forming Equipment: Plate Bending Machines (for rolling cylinders), Head Spinning Machines (for forming heads).
- Welding Equipment: Automatic Welding Machines, TIG Welding Machines (to ensure welding quality).
- Machining Equipment: Lathes, Milling Machines, Drilling Machines (for processing accessories).
- Inspection Equipment: Non-destructive Testing (NDT) Equipment (UT/MT/PT/RT), Hardness Testers, Thickness Gauges.
Key Processes
- Cutting: Precision cutting to avoid material waste.
- Forming: Cylinder rolling and head forming to ensure dimensional accuracy.
- Welding: Strictly execute Welding Procedure Specifications (WPS), adopt multi-layer and multi-pass welding to avoid welding defects.
- Heat Treatment: Eliminate welding stresses and improve material properties (e.g., annealing, tempering).
IV. Personnel Requirements (Necessary Qualifications)
Certificated Employment
- Welders: Must hold a Special Equipment Welding Operator Certificate with a welding scope that covers the products.
- Inspectors: Must hold a Special Equipment Inspector Certificate and be responsible for non-destructive testing and visual inspection.
- Designers: Must possess qualifications in pressure vessel design.
- Managers: Must be familiar with relevant standards and regulations.
Professional Training
- All personnel must receive regular professional training to keep abreast of the latest standards and operating procedures.
V. Quality Control Process
In-process Inspection
- Raw Material Inspection: Verify material certificates and conduct mechanical property tests.
- Cutting Inspection: Check dimensions and groove angles.
- Welding Inspection: Perform visual inspection and non-destructive testing (UT/MT/PT/RT).
- Forming Inspection: Check dimensional accuracy and surface quality.
Final Product Inspection
- Hydrostatic Test: Conducted via water pressure testing or pneumatic testing to verify tightness and strength.
- Air Tightness Test: To check for leaks.
- Visual Inspection: Ensure the surface is free of defects and dimensions meet requirements.
Documentation
- Complete quality certification documents must be issued, including material certificates, welding records, inspection reports, and certificates of conformity.
VI. Safety and Environmental Protection Requirements
Safety Requirements
- Strictly comply with safety operating procedures during manufacturing and ensure the 配备 of safety protection facilities.
- For vessels containing toxic or flammable media, special protective measures must be implemented.
Environmental Protection Requirements
- Welding fumes, wastewater, and waste materials must comply with environmental standards and be properly disposed of.
VII. Certification and Registration
Product Certification
- A Special Equipment Manufacturing License (TS Certification) is required to manufacture pressure vessels.
